3. Implement a Strategic Sales Funnel
Effective marketing hinges on a well-structured sales funnel. Meilke highlights the importance of lead generation through valuable content that attracts potential clients. “Engage them through consultations,” she says, emphasizing the need to offer insights and advice that resonate with their needs. Closing sales becomes a natural outcome of this relationship-building process. Knowing your ideal client profile and understanding metrics like client lifetime value and cost per acquisition are crucial for developing a robust marketing strategy.

Tax Preparation News
The IRS is cracking down on tax preparers who use shady practices. Because Congress gave them more money, the IRS is now working harder to catch tax preparers who are breaking tax laws. These preparers guide clients to say they earned less money or deserve more tax breaks than they do. This causes trouble for taxpayers, who might later face audits or owe more taxes.
This crackdown especially affects small businesses and a specific tax break called the employee retention credit (ERC). In the pandemic, they made the ERC to help small businesses that kept their employees even when things were tough.
Because Congress gave them more money, the IRS is now working harder to catch tax preparers who are breaking the law.
But some people have been taking advantage of it wrongly, making false claims. To deal with this, the IRS has stopped taking new claims for the ERC for now. The American Institute of CPAs (AICPA) supports this decision.
The IRS is keeping a closer eye on things to make the tax filing process fairer. Their goal is to protect honest taxpayers and tax preparers who follow the rules and punish those who try to cheat. The IRS is using advanced technology, like maybe artificial intelligence, to change how audits work, especially for wealthier taxpayers.
The IRS is making these moves to make sure everyone follows tax rules and making sure the government gets the money it needs.
